Bulldogs look to continue recent success

Published on February 27, 2006 under American Hockey League (AHL)
Hamilton Bulldogs News Release


The Hamilton Bulldogs (26-32-0-3) look to continue their recent success this week as they finish their current seven-game road trip with four games in five nights. Hamilton has won a season high four games in a row and seven of their last eight. The Bulldogs have also won a season-high four consecutive road games and have earned at least one point in their last six contests away from Copps Coliseum.

Hamilton begins the week in Texas, first facing the San Antonio Rampage (17-35-1-4) on Tuesday, February 28 (8:00 p.m.) before battling the Houston Aeros (41-14-1-2) on Thursday, March 2. The ‘Dogs then play back-to-back games against the Cleveland Barons (22-36-2-2) on Friday, March 3 (7:05 p.m.) and Saturday, March 4 (7:05 p.m.).

Player Notes

- C Marc Antoine Pouliot is on a four-game point streak, posting eight points (4g-4a). Pouliot recorded a professional career-high four points (1g-3a) in the Bulldogs' 6-5 (OT) victory against the Syracuse Crunch on Friday, February 24. On Sunday, February 26, he scored twice, including the game-winner with one minute remaining in regulation, as Hamilton defeated Rochester 6-4. e

- RW Andrei Kostitsyn has posted one goal and one assist in each of his last three games.

- LW Pierre Dagenais has four goals in his last three games.

- C Corey Locke has posted three assists in his last two games.

- G Olivier Michaud has won all four of his starts since being recalled from the Long Beach Ice Dogs (ECHL) on January 31.

- G Jaroslav Halak stopped 38 of 40 shots as well as three of four shootout attempts in his AHL debut on Saturday, February 25 as Hamilton defeated the Binghamton Senators 3-2.
